Can you cancel a cashier's check and receive a refund of the funds?

Yes, you can cancel a cashier's check and receive a refund of the funds, but the process may vary depending on the bank's policies. Typically, you will need to contact the bank that issued the cashier's check and follow their specific procedures for cancellation and refund.

Can any bank cash a cashier's check?

Not all banks will cash a cashier's check. Some banks may require you to have an account with them in order to cash a cashier's check, while others may charge a fee for cashing a check if you are not a customer. It's best to check with the specific bank you plan to visit to see their policies on cashing cashier's checks.
